#d21b05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d21b05 is composed of 82.4% red, 10.6%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.1% magenta, 97.6%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 6.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 42.2%. #d21b05 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ff360a with #a50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#d21b05 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d21b05 has RGB values of R:210, G:27,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.98,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13769477.

Shades and Tints of #d21b05
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120200 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d21b05
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6968 is the less saturated color, while #d21b05 is the most saturated one.
